Hello! Today I’m sharing my first project with the adorable ‘Cute Witch’ from Rachelle Anne Miller. The little owl on her hat is just the cutest! I was able to print and cut the image with my Cricut Maker 3. I colored the image with copic sketch markers and then I added some glitter and white gel pen accents. I wanted to make it an interactive card, so I used the ‘Lets Toast pull-tab add-on’ to make the witch fly through the sky.
I used distress oxides to color the background in a nice purple tone and splattered a little water mixed with liquid stardust to create some more interest.
The sentiment was heat embossed with black embossing powder and lastly I added some iridescent stars to the background. And that’s all. This way the cute witch and her owl are the star of the card and I hope you like it!
